Comments:
-!- FUNCTION: In addition to polymerase activity, this DNA polymerase
exhibits 3' to 5' and 5' to 3' exonuclease activity (By
similarity).
-!- CATALYTIC ACTIVITY: Deoxynucleoside triphosphate + DNA(n) =
diphosphate + DNA(n+1).
-!- SUBUNIT: Single-chain monomer with multiple functions.
-!- SIMILARITY: Belongs to the DNA polymerase type-A family.
-!- SIMILARITY: Contains 1 3'-5' exonuclease domain.
-!- SIMILARITY: Contains 1 5'-3' exonuclease domain.
